Was watching a documentary on Rugby today and what impressed me more than the game itself was the Maori dance performed by the New Zealand All Blacks before the game begins – Haka. It is performed with vigorous movements and stamping of the feet with rhythmically shouted accompaniment. It is a way of throwing down the gauntlet to the other team and daring them to accept the challenge. I really do wonder how the opposing team players would feel during this spectacle but I personally wouldn’t want to mess with these guys after the dance.
